How to Fix Phone Camera Qr Scan Not Working

Check Your Camera Permissions and Settings

One of the most common reasons your QR scanner might not work is due to permission issues. If the camera app or scanner app doesn’t have the necessary permissions, it won’t be able to access the camera to scan QR codes.

  • Go to your device’s Settings.
  • Navigate to Apps & Notifications (or Apps).
  • Select the specific app you’re using to scan QR codes (e.g., the camera app or a third-party scanner app).
  • Check the Permissions section.
  • Ensure that Camera permission is enabled.

Additionally, verify that the camera is not restricted in any way, such as restrictions set for privacy or parental controls.

Test the Camera Functionality

Before troubleshooting the QR code scanner specifically, confirm whether your camera is working correctly in general:

  • Open your device’s default Camera app.
  • Take a few photos or record a short video.
  • If the camera is blurry, black, or not functioning at all, the issue may be with the camera hardware or software.

If the camera isn’t working properly in the default app, consider restarting your device or performing a camera app reset. If hardware issues persist, contacting a professional technician may be necessary.

Update Your Device Software and Apps

Outdated software can cause compatibility issues that prevent QR scanners from functioning properly. Keep your device and apps up to date to ensure smooth operation.

  • Go to Settings > Software Update (or System Update).
  • Download and install any available updates.
  • Visit your device’s app store (Google Play Store or Apple App Store).
  • Update your camera app, QR scanner app, and any related apps.

Sometimes, app developers release patches to fix bugs that may cause the QR scanner to malfunction. Regular updates help maintain optimal performance.

Clear Cache and Data of the QR Scanner App

If you’re using a third-party QR code scanner app, clearing its cache and data can resolve glitches:

  • Open Settings > Apps & Notifications > See All Apps.
  • Find and select your QR scanner app.
  • Tap on Storage & Cache.
  • Choose Clear Cache and then Clear Data.

Note: Clearing data will reset the app to its original state, so you may need to set it up again after this step.

Check for Obstructions and Clean Your Camera Lens

Physical issues like dirt, smudges, or debris on your camera lens can impact image clarity and scanning ability:

  • Use a soft, lint-free cloth to gently clean the lens.
  • Avoid using harsh chemicals that could damage the lens.
  • Ensure there are no obstructions blocking the camera.

A clean lens provides a clearer image, making it easier for your camera to recognize QR codes.

Test with Different QR Codes and Lighting Conditions

The quality and condition of the QR code, as well as ambient lighting, can affect scan success:

  • Try scanning a different QR code from a different source.
  • Ensure the QR code is well-lit and not blurry or damaged.
  • Avoid glare, reflections, or shadows that could obscure the code.

Adjust your position or lighting to improve scan accuracy.

Reset Your Device to Factory Settings (As a Last Resort)

If none of the above solutions work, and you suspect a software glitch or corruption, performing a factory reset may help. Be sure to back up all important data before proceeding.

  • Go to Settings > System > Reset options > Erase all data (factory reset).
  • Follow on-screen instructions to reset your device.
  • Set up your device anew and test the QR scanner.

This step should only be taken after other troubleshooting methods have failed, as it erases all data and settings.

Consult Professional Support or Service Center

If your camera still refuses to scan QR codes after trying all the above steps, there might be a hardware issue with your camera module. In such cases, contacting your device manufacturer’s support or visiting an authorized service center is advisable.

Hardware problems might require repairs or part replacements to restore full camera functionality.
